Ingredients of Chicken Kosha
-
You need 500 gms of chicken with bones, curry cut.
-
You need 2 of onion sliced.
-
You need 1" of ginger sliced.
-
It’s 3-4 of garlic cloves sliced.
-
Prepare 1 cup of yogurt beaten.
-
It’s 2 tbsp. of kashmiri red chilli powder.
-
You need to taste of salt.
-
Prepare 1 tsp. of roasted coriander powder.
-
It’s 1 tsp. of garam masala powder.
-
You need 1 tsp. of roasted cumin powder.
-
Prepare 1/2 cup of fried onions.
-
You need 1 tsp. of ghee.
-
It’s 3 tbsp. of oil.
-
It’s 1 tsp. of coriander leaves chopped.

Chicken Kosha is an age-old Bengali way of cooking Chicken.
Like Kosha Mangsho this one is also high on spice level and not for faint-hearted. 😉 The word Kosha (a Bengali word) means dryish or a gravy which is quite dry in consistency.
It's a popular dish; every Bengali family cooks it in their own way, so, the recipe may vary a little bit from home to home.
Chicken Kosha step by step
-
Heat 1 tbsp. oil in a pan and fry the onion, ginger and garlic till light brown. Keep aside to cool down and then grind to a fine paste..
-
Marinate the chicken with a pinch of salt and red chilli powder for 10 minutes. Heat remaining oil in a pan and fry the chicken pieces till light brown..
-
Add the onion paste and 1/2 cup water. Mix well and cook, covered on a low flame for 5-10 minutes..
-
Add the yogurt, salt, red chilli powder, coriander powder and cumin powder. Mix well and simmer further till the chicken turns soft..
-
When done, add the garam masala powder and ghee. Give it a stir and switch off the flame. Keep it covered for 5 minutes..
-
Garnish with fried onions and coriander leaves. Serve as a side dish with any form of rice or Indian bread..
